**Ticket: Parcel webhook creds expired — Driftpost plugins**

Hey plugin folks — the shared credential for the Driftpost parcel-tracking webhook expired over the weekend, so your delivery-status callbacks have been bouncing with 401s since Saturday. Nothing's wrong with your code; it's our rotation script that skipped a cycle. We've minted a fresh credential and bumped its expiry to 90 days. Swap it into your webhook config and re-register any failed subscriptions. The new key for the Driftpost relay is below.

API key for yahig-tadup: kto7_ubizbYm

## Service Accounts — StormFan Alert Fan-Out

The fan-out worker authenticates to the internal dispatch tier using the svc-stormfan account. Rotate quarterly; scopes are limited to publish-only on alert topics. If deliveries stall during your shift, verify the worker is using the current credential, reproduced below for reference.

API key for kaweg-hahif: kto4_rAjZ

## Runbook: Loyalty Ledger Reconciliation (Pebblewise Rewards)

New to the team? Read this fully before touching the ledger. The loyalty-points ledger is the source of truth for all member balances; downstream caches derive from it. If the nightly reconciliation job reports drift, do not manually adjust balances — open an incident and run the verify script first, which compares ledger totals against the redemption log. The script prompts for confirmation twice before writing anything. It connects to the ledger database using the string below.

replica DSN, yahaf-yagaf: mongodb://tamath_svc:a2netSk3RZMuTj@db-d084.novacsoft.internal:5432/ralmir

Handover: Varga cluster health checks. The Bridgewell load balancer now uses the /deepcheck endpoint; shallow checks were marking drained nodes healthy. Release manager note: do not promote builds that change the health path without updating LB config in the same window. Rollback steps are in the runbook. Threshold settings and the drain procedure are documented on the internal page here.

runbook for badug-kadup: https://confluence.zemvarlabs.internal/projects/browse/display/projects/bd1b